Full Description
Trenched evaluation followed by full excavation in 1999 prior to extension on W side of school located major ditch thought to be part of castle outer bailey, part back-filled by the 12th or 13th century, and other ditches, pits and post holes (including Iron Age). A substantial Mid to Late Saxon (enclosure ?) ditch was also located. Details in (S1)(S2). East of church (HGH 008), and edge of castle bailey (HGH 001).

Finds (8)
- FSF26292: POTTERY (Medieval to IPS: Post Medieval - 1066 AD to 1900 AD)
- FSF26293: POTTERY THETFORD (IPS: Early Late Saxon to 12th century - 850 AD to 1100 AD)
- FSF26294: COIN (13th century - 1247 AD to 1272 AD)
- FSF34150: POTTERY (Late Bronze Age to Late Iron Age - 1000 BC to 42 AD)
- FSF34151: POTTERY IPSWICH (Middle Saxon - 650 AD to 849 AD)
- FSF34152: WINDOW GLASS (Medieval - 1066 AD to 1539 AD)
- FSF34153: ANIMAL REMAINS (Late Bronze Age to IPS: Modern - 1000 BC to 2050 AD)
- FSF34154: LITHIC IMPLEMENT (Later Prehistoric - 4000 BC to 42 AD)
